Cut fruit into halves or quarters, place it centered in the filter, and press the handle down fully and steadily. Very hard or dry fruit may naturally yield less juice than fresh, ripe fruit.
Is this manual juicer difficult to clean after making juice?
No. Rinse the parts with warm water immediately after use and wipe away pulp. The simple structure is designed for quick hand washing only; do not put it in the dishwasher.
The aluminum parts feel flimsy. Will the metal bend or break with normal use?
The juicer uses an aluminum alloy suitable for everyday hand-press juicing. Avoid using extreme force or pressing oversized, uncut fruit to prevent stress on the metal joints.
Juice sometimes splashes out when I press. How can I reduce mess while squeezing?
Make sure the filter and cup are properly aligned, do not overfill with fruit, and press the handle down smoothly instead of slamming it. This helps keep juice inside the container.
Can I use this juicer for any kind of fruit, including hard or fibrous ones?
It works best for soft, juicy fruits like citrus, pomegranate arils, and similar produce. Very hard, fibrous, or oversized fruits should be cut smaller or are not recommended.
